using System;
using System.ComponentModel.Composition;
using System.Diagnostics;
using System.Threading;
using System.Threading.Tasks;
using System.Windows;
using System.Windows.Controls;
using dnSpy.Contracts.Language.Intellisense;
using dnSpy.Contracts.Settings.AppearanceCategory;
using dnSpy.Contracts.Text;
using dnSpy.Roslyn.Text;
using dnSpy.Roslyn.Text.Classification;
using Microsoft.CodeAnalysis.Completion;
using Microsoft.VisualStudio.Language.Intellisense;
using Microsoft.VisualStudio.Utilities;
namespace dnSpy.Roslyn.Intellisense.Completions {
[Export(typeof(IUIElementProvider<Completion, ICompletionSession>))]
[Name(PredefinedUIElementProviderNames.RoslynCompletionToolTipProvider)]
[ContentType(ContentTypes.RoslynCode)]
sealed class CompletionToolTipProvider : IUIElementProvider<Completion, ICompletionSession> {
readonly IContentType contentType;
readonly ITaggedTextElementProviderService taggedTextElementProviderService;
WeakReference? lastAsyncToolTipContentWeakReference;
[ImportingConstructor]
CompletionToolTipProvider(IContentTypeRegistryService contentTypeRegistryService, ITaggedTextElementProviderService taggedTextElementProviderService) {
contentType = contentTypeRegistryService.GetContentType(RoslynContentTypes.CompletionToolTipRoslyn);
this.taggedTextElementProviderService = taggedTextElementProviderService;
}
public UIElement? GetUIElement(Completion itemToRender, ICompletionSession context, UIElementType elementType) {
if (elementType != UIElementType.Tooltip)
return null;
if (lastAsyncToolTipContentWeakReference?.Target is AsyncToolTipContent lastAsyncToolTipContent && lastAsyncToolTipContent.Session == context) {
lastAsyncToolTipContent.Cancel();
lastAsyncToolTipContentWeakReference = null;
}
var roslynCompletion = itemToRender as RoslynCompletion;
if (roslynCompletion is null)
return null;
var roslynCollection = context.SelectedCompletionSet as RoslynCompletionSet;
Debug2.Assert(roslynCollection is not null);
if (roslynCollection is null)
return null;
const bool colorize = true;
var result = new AsyncToolTipContent(this, roslynCollection, roslynCompletion, context, taggedTextElementProviderService, colorize);
lastAsyncToolTipContentWeakReference = result.IsDisposed ? null : new WeakReference(result);
return result;
}
sealed class AsyncToolTipContent : ContentControl {
public ICompletionSession Session { get; }
readonly CompletionToolTipProvider owner;
readonly CancellationTokenSource cancellationTokenSource;
readonly ITaggedTextElementProviderService taggedTextElementProviderService;
readonly bool colorize;
public AsyncToolTipContent(CompletionToolTipProvider owner, RoslynCompletionSet completionSet, RoslynCompletion completion, ICompletionSession session, ITaggedTextElementProviderService taggedTextElementProviderService, bool colorize) {
this.owner = owner;
Session = session;
cancellationTokenSource = new CancellationTokenSource();
this.taggedTextElementProviderService = taggedTextElementProviderService;
this.colorize = colorize;
Session.Dismissed += Session_Dismissed;
Unloaded += AsyncToolTipContent_Unloaded;
GetDescriptionAsync(completionSet, completion, cancellationTokenSource.Token)
.ContinueWith(t => {
var ex = t.Exception;
Dispose();
}, CancellationToken.None, TaskContinuationOptions.None, TaskScheduler.FromCurrentSynchronizationContext());
}
async Task GetDescriptionAsync(RoslynCompletionSet completionSet, RoslynCompletion completion, CancellationToken cancellationToken) {
var description = await completionSet.GetDescriptionAsync(completion, cancellationToken);
if (description is null || description.TaggedParts.IsDefault || description.TaggedParts.Length == 0)
InitializeDefaultDocumentation();
else
Content = CreateContent(description);
}
object CreateContent(CompletionDescription description) {
using (var elemProvider = taggedTextElementProviderService.Create(owner.contentType, AppearanceCategoryConstants.UIMisc))
return elemProvider.Create(string.Empty, description.TaggedParts, colorize);
}
void InitializeDefaultDocumentation() => Visibility = Visibility.Collapsed;
void AsyncToolTipContent_Unloaded(object? sender, RoutedEventArgs e) => Cancel();
void Session_Dismissed(object? sender, EventArgs e) => Cancel();
public void Cancel() {
if (disposed)
return;
cancellationTokenSource.Cancel();
Dispose();
}
void Dispose() {
if (disposed)
return;
disposed = true;
cancellationTokenSource.Dispose();
Session.Dismissed -= Session_Dismissed;
Unloaded -= AsyncToolTipContent_Unloaded;
if (owner.lastAsyncToolTipContentWeakReference?.Target == this)
owner.lastAsyncToolTipContentWeakReference = null;
}
bool disposed;
public bool IsDisposed => disposed;
}
}
}
